Tarun Das v. State Of West Bengal And ORS.
22-06-2021 ct no. 13 Sl.8 sp WPA 2758 of 2021 Tarun Das -VersusState of West Bengal & Ors.
(Through Video Conference) Mr. Sabyasachi Mukherjee Ms. Arunima Das Sharma ....for the petitioner Mr. Jishnu Chowdhury, Ms. Manali Ali, Mr. Arka Chowdhury ....for the State-respondents The Assistant Commissioner of Police, Barrackpore Police Commissionerate has filed a report. The same is taken on record.
Counsel for the State shall circulate a copy of the report to the petitioner as well as the respondent nos. 5 and 6.
It appears from the report that a discreet enquiry was conducted on the allegations against the respondent no. 5 and no evidence was found. The only issue that remains is that the private respondent no. 6 has forcibly evicted the petitioner.
This Court cannot enter into the merits of the disputes between the petitioner and the private respondent no. 6. The parties are
contesting a Civil Suit and the same may be pursued before the Civil Court in accordance with law.
Insofar as the petitioner's allegations that the civil Court's order has not been enforced by the police, the ACP, Barrackpore Police Commissionerate has stated in his report that the orders of the Civil Court are indeed being complied with by the concerned Police Station. It is directed that the Assistant Commissioner of Police, Barrackpore Police Commissionerate shall monitor the functioning of the Dumdum Police Station insofar as the concerned orders of the Civil Court ensure the compliance thereof.
With the aforesaid directions, the writ petition is disposed of.
There shall be no order as to costs.
